It is 1946. Henry Miles, a civil servant, suspects that his wife Sarah is having an affair, and asks his writer friend Maurice Bendrix to contact a private investigator on his behalf. Maurice has a secret, however: he was once Sarah's lover, and is equally keen to find out whether she was unfaithful to him too... this economical and intense adaptation of Graham Greene's acclaimed novel unravels Maurice's story in a series of flashbacks on a stylized, fluid setting. Issues of Catholic faith, marital duplicity, sexuality and the supernatural are squarely dealt with, music and humour leavening the atmosphere and adding ironic comment.
